life is what you make it. Im pretty happy doing food service deliverly. I'm not a hermit i get to talk to a ton of people everyday, do some pretty challenging things like take a rig set up for over the road driving (condo sleeper 48 ft reefer) into inner city bronx and queens where i have no business with a 65ft house and manage to make that corner that all the locals said I wouldn't.
3 generation trucker in my family. matter of fact my dad started out doing the exact same thing im doing and in the same city also. food service is deff not your regular driving job tho.
If you told me 2yrs ago id be driving I'd of told you no way, kind of just happened i guess..... driving came naturally to me, used to race motocross since I was a wee little guy......pops owned a stone quarry business on the side, i was always messing around with the skidsteer and 973 dozer. thats what turns you into a man not playing video games all day -

Trucking has gotten me a home, a couple of rental properties, a couple of vehicles, a Harley, and a divorce.
I'm not educated, but I have a nice lifestyle and I'm generally happy with my choice of profession. In the 24 years I've been doing it I've thought about quitting a few times, but there's nothing like seeing the sunrise on a lonesome highway with only your own thoughts.redoctober83 Thanks this. -
